Ingrédients pour Crisp Garlic Potato Skins
- Baking Potatoes
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- Tomatoes
- Dried Basil
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 2 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ese

Comment préparer Crisp Garlic Potato Skins
-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C).
- Prick 4 large russet potatoes several times with a fork.
- Bake for 40-50 minutes, or until tender.
- Let potatoes cool completely. Wrap tightly and ref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or overnight.
- Cut the cooled potatoes into quarters lengthwise.
- Using a spoon, scoop out the potato flesh, leaving a ½-inch thick shell.
- Lightly brush both sides of the potato skins with 1 tablespoon olive oil.
- Arrange potato skins, cut-side up, on a large baking sheet.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until golden brown and crispy.
- While potato skins bake, prepare the topping: In a small bowl, combine 1 cup chopped tomatoes, 2 tablespoons chopped fresh basil, 1 teaspoon garlic powder, and ¼ teaspoon salt (optional).
- Spoon the tomato mixture into each potato skin.
- Sprinkle generously with 2 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ese.
- Bake for 2-3 more minutes, or until heated through and cheese is melted and bubbly.
